** The pest control market in and around Ashmore, Illinois, is characterized by a reliance on service providers from larger neighboring towns, primarily Mattoon and Charleston. As a small, rural community, there are no pest control companies physically located within Ashmore itself. The competition is moderate, with a mix of national franchises (like Orkin) and strong, long-standing local businesses. The average quality of service is high, as these companies have built their reputation on serving the agricultural and residential communities of Coles County. Customer reviews frequently highlight responsiveness, effectiveness, and local knowledge as key differentiators. Typical pricing is competitive with national averages. A standard one-time treatment for common insects (ants, roaches) can range from $150-$300. Ongoing quarterly preventative programs are popular and typically cost between $100-$200 per visit. More specialized services like termite treatments (often requiring tenting and liquid barriers) or wildlife removal (e.g., raccoons, bats) are more costly, generally starting at $1,200 and can go significantly higher depending on the infestation's severity and the property's size. Most reputable companies offer free initial inspections and quotes.

In Ashmore, homeowners most frequently deal with ants, spiders, rodents (mice and voles), and occasional termite activity due to our rural setting and Illinois' humid continental climate. Seasonal peaks are critical: ants and spiders are most active from spring through fall, while rodents seek shelter in homes as early as late September when temperatures drop. Termite swarms typically occur in Illinois during April and May, which is the key time to watch for signs of infestation.
For a standard quarterly exterior treatment targeting common insects, Ashmore homeowners can expect to pay between $100-$150 per service visit. One-time services for specific issues, like rodent exclusion, typically range from $250-$500. Pricing in Coles County is generally moderate but can vary based on your home's square footage, the severity of the issue, and if your property has extensive outbuildings common in our rural area.
Yes. Any company applying pesticides in Illinois must be licensed and insured through the Illinois Department of Agriculture. A reputable provider will have a Qualified Applicator License (QAL) or be operating under one. For termite treatments, state law requires companies to provide you with a detailed contract and, for soil treatments, a diagram of the treatment area. Always ask to see proof of current licensing before hiring.
Prioritize companies with strong local experience, as they understand the specific pest pressures of Coles County's agricultural and residential mix. Look for providers offering integrated pest management (IPM) strategies, which focus on prevention and minimal chemical use. Check for verified online reviews, ask for local references, and ensure they provide clear, written service guarantees and detailed explanations of the products and methods they plan to use on your property.
Given Ashmore's seasonal extremes and proximity to farmland and open fields, a preventative plan is highly recommended. Proactive quarterly treatments create a barrier that stops common insects before they enter, which is more effective and often more economical than reactive emergency calls. This is especially important for termites, as the damage they cause is often not visible until it's extensive and costly to repair; an annual inspection is a wise investment.
